Pros

They are finally bringing up salaries from minimum wage, and some managers will work with your schedules. If you enjoy being busy, this is the place.

Cons

Full time is supposed to be 32 hours or more a week. Usually got around 30 instead. They have reduced the total weekly store hours so much that there is sometimes only 3 people total per day, 1 in the morning and 2 to close. This also means you are over tasked, given more to do in less time that the company guidelines call for. Trying to get the tasks done when you are the only one in the store is very hard, you may have assignments that take you to the back of the store, at the same time your the cashier. The stores are too big for 1 person to monitor safely. The company will not spend money on the physical stores at all unless they have been sited. They are dirty because no time is allotted for cleaning. The company only sends people to clean the floors once a year, so the older stores with tile look horrible.
